Bank Holidays 2026: The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has officially released the list of bank holidays for Andhra Pradesh and Telangana for the year 2026. Customers are advised to plan their banking activities in advance to avoid inconvenience during holidays.
Apart from national holidays, some bank holidays differ between Andhra Pradesh and Telangana due to regional festivals. As usual, all Sundays and the second and fourth Saturdays of every month will remain bank holidays across both states. These festive holidays apply in addition to those regular weekly closures.
The RBI clarified that online banking, mobile banking, UPI, and ATM services will continue to operate without interruption even on bank holidays. Customers can use digital services for fund transfers, bill payments, and other transactions.
It is also worth noting that Diwali falls on Sunday, November 8, in 2026, so banks will already remain closed on that day due to the weekly holiday.
Complete List of Bank Holidays in AP and Telangana – 2026
January
January 15 – Makar Sankranti
January 26 – Republic Day
March
March 3 – Holi
March 19 – Ugadi
March 20 – Ramzan (Andhra Pradesh)
March 21 – Ramzan (Telangana)
March 27 – Sri Rama Navami
April
April 1 – Annual Accounts Closing
April 3 – Good Friday
April 14 – Dr BR Ambedkar Jayanti
May
May 1 – May Day
May 27 – Bakrid
June
June 25 – Muharram (Andhra Pradesh)
June 26 – Muharram (Telangana)
July
No special bank holidays
August
August 15 – Independence Day
August 25 – Milad-un-Nabi (Andhra Pradesh)
August 26 – Milad-un-Nabi (Telangana)
September
September 4 – Sri Krishna Janmashtami
September 14 – Vinayaka Chavithi
October
October 2 – Mahatma Gandhi Jayanti
October 20 – Vijayadashami
November
November 24 – Guru Nanak Jayanti (Telangana only)
December
December 25 – Christmas
